KS3 ICT

During KS3 students will have one lesson a week in formal ICT – it is also incorporated in other subjects.

Students study a variety of practical tasks using different software applications.

KS4 ICT

Students from the end of Year 9 through to Year 11 work on the European Computer Driving Licence – at Levels 2 and 3. To acehive the equivalent of a GCSE (Level 2), students complete the following modules:

Module 1 – Computer Theory (security)

Module 2 – IT User Fundamentals

Module 3 – Word Processing

Module 4 – Spreadsheets

Module 5 – Databases

Module 6 – Presentations

Module 7 – Internet & Email

Extra Unit – Improving Productivity Using IT

 

Students who complete the ECDL to Level 2 can go on to Level 3 (Advanced), which covers:

Advanced Word Processing

Advanced Spreadsheets

Advanced Databases

Advanced Presentations
